Project Identification
- Project Reference Number
- WR/AWMA/DACF/IGF/WKS/NCT/05/2024
- Project Name
- Rehabilitation Of The Mpcu Block
- Sector
- Housing & Buildings
- Project Type
- Rehabilitation / Renovation
- Project Location
- Western Region
- Purpose
- Enhances functionality, service delivery, and staff working conditions; prolongs asset life; and contributes to local employment during works
- Project Description
- Rehabilitation works to improve the structural condition, functionality, and usability of the MPCU Block, including repairs, refurbishment, and upgrading of essential building services
Project Preparation
- Project Scope
- Rehabilitation of the MPCU Block, including structural repairs, refurbishment of finishes, upgrading of electrical and plumbing systems, roofing, and associated ancillary works
- Environmental Impact
- EPA Category: C – Minimal environmental impact associated with rehabilitation of an existing building
- Land and Settlement Impact
- None—the project is within an existing facility with no land acquisition or displacement
- Design Standard
- Designed in accordance with the Ghana Building Code, LGWD standards, and applicable British/International Standards
- Expected Life of Asset
- 30–40 years (post-rehabilitation)

Project Completion
- Project Status
- Completed
- Completion Cost
- GHS 418,396.90
- Completion Date
- Fri Dec 06 2024
- Scope at Completion
- Completion includes all structural repairs, building refurbishment, electrical and plumbing works, roofing and finishes, site clearance, and formal handover in accordance with approved standards
